Page 1 of 6 <br /> <br />AGREEMENT FOR KITTITAS COUNTY UPPER DISTRICT COURT <br />INDIGENT DEFENSE SERVICES 2023 <br /> <br />This agreement is entered into by and between the County of Kittitas (County) and Heritage Law <br />Office, Elizabeth Gagley, Contracting Attorney WSBA #54517 <br /> <br />1. Scope of Services. The Contracting Attorney agrees to provide, or arrange for the provision of, <br />public defender services for all eligible indigent criminal defendants in cases filed in the Upper <br />Kittitas County District Court as set forth in this agreement. The Contracting Attorney or other <br />assigned counsel shall provide legal representation for each assigned defendant from the time of <br />receiving notice of appointment through every stage of the legal proceedings at the district court <br />level including sentencing and the processing of notices of appeal and motions for orders of <br />indigence for direct appeals. The Contracting Attorney shall provide legal representation for <br />review hearings (e.g. probation review hearings) when appointed for that purpose. The <br />Contracting Attorney shall also provide legal representation for the arraignment calendars held <br />on Mondays at 9:00 am. All cases assigned to the Contracting Attorney as of the date of <br />termination of this contract for which the next set hearing date is within 45 days after such date <br />of termination will be handled as set forth above; provided, that in any case where the client fails <br />to appear for a trial or hearing after termination of the contract, the Contracting Attorney may <br />withdraw from representation subject to order of the court and thereafter the Contracting <br />Attorney shall have no obligation herein to represent the client or accept reappointment <br />thereafter. <br /> <br />2. Heritage Law as Independent Contractor. The parties recognize and affirm the understanding <br />that the Heritage Law Office is an independent contractor having no relationship to the County <br />except to provide professional legal defense services to the persons officially assigned to the <br />Attorney pursuant to this Contract. Neither the Attorney nor any employee of the Attorney is an <br />employee of the County. Neither the Attorney nor any employee of the Attorney is entitled to <br />any benefits that the County provides its employees. The Attorney will provide the Kittitas <br />County Department of Public Defense with proof of a valid Washington Uniform Business <br />Identification number before commencement of work. Heritage Law Office is solely responsible <br />for the timely payment of any taxes, assessments, statutory workers compensation, or employer’s <br />liability insurance as required by Federal or state law for the Attorney and any employees of the <br />Attorney. The Attorney guarantees such payment and will indemnify the County in that regard. <br /> <br />3. Applicant Screening.
